After breakfast, visit the park: 
In Ranomafana National Park where you can admire some twenty species of mammals including 12 lemur namely the famous bamboo lemur lemurs. 
Several animal species have been recorded: 
- 115 species of birds including thirty of them are strictly forest species. 
- 90 species of butterflies, 
- 98 species of amphibians, 
- Some species of fish 
- And 62 species of reptiles: Chameleons, lizards. 
Visit at Sahambavy, Sahambavy is particularly known for its tea plantations. The latter are spread over 300 hectares.

6-7-8 DAY: SAHAMBAVY-ANDRINGITRA
We leave Sahambavy the morning to continue to Fianarantsoa and Ambalavao. Visit the center of the paper and continue to Antemoro Andringitra National Park. Andringitra is 47 km south of Ambalavao along National Road No. 7 in the region of Upper Matsiatra. The park covers 31,160 ha. Perched on the heights, its altitude varies between 650 and 2658 m. 
Concentrated endemism and diversity, biodiversity Andringitra is preserved by the provision of park slope and rock masses. 
Andringitra is one of the park more attractive because it has the form of fabulous landscape of hills, rock with beautiful waterfalls and plants. Camping (two nights).

Lemur_in_IsaloDAY 9: ANDRINGITRA - ISALO.
Morning visit to the park and Ambalavao Anja, we continue to drive up Ranohira Isalo. 
Isalo is part of the Common Ranohira in the region Ihorombe. It is 279 km south of Fianarantsoa and 80 km from Ihosy. The park, crisscrossed by rivers and their tributaries, extends over 81,540 ha. This is a massive ruiniform sandstone plateau continental Jurassic. Heavily eroded, broken up only by the witnesses sandy valleys and canyons remained: a truly exceptional performance.

DAY 10: ISALO
Isalo animals are typical of the climate, vegetation and geomorphology of the park. They are, overwhelmingly, endemic species. 77 species of birds live in the Isalo thrush or Pseudocosyphus Benson Benson, a species endemic to Madagascar, which is highly protected. There are also 14 species of lemurs and moths introduced with 8 and 7 endemic in Madagascar. Reptiles, amphibians, carnivores, insectivores and rodents complete the list.

domaine_d_ambolaDAY 11-12-13: ISALO – DOMAINE D’ AMBOLA
Early in the morning, leaving Isalo we take a road lined with baobab, tombs decorated Mahafaly tribe way that are unique to their gender. It runs along Lake Tsimanampetsotsa. It is a large shallow lake. The main attractions of the book are 70 species of birds, The National Park covers 43,200 ha Tsimanampesotse.Lake Tsimanampesotse is the first Ramsar site in Madagascar classified by the International Convention on Wetlands. It is also the only protected area located on the limestone plateau and the coastal area along the coastline of the South West. 
Tsimanampesotse includes, among others, 112 species of birds including 5 species of Coua the nine existing 42 species of herpetofauna, including 39 reptiles, 3 species of lemurs including 2 diurnal (Lemur catta and Propithecus verreauxii verreauxii and 2 night (Microcebus griseorufus and Lepilemur). 
1. The Pink Flamingo, a bird endemic to the rosy wings. Seen all year on Lake Tsimanampesotse.
